## Handover: tailwisp CLI

Handing over the tailwisp log-tailing CLI to Priya's team. It authenticates against the Cinderport broker using short-lived tokens, and all tail sessions are scoped read-only to the requesting user's namespace. No credentials are stored on disk; the token cache lives in memory only. The default runtime configuration it ships with appears below.

service settings:
[casax]
port = 6379
team = rusir
host = casax.zemvarhq.corp
region = outer-4
access_code = ac_9808ce
timeout_ms = 1500

## Account Recovery — Pedalshift Rebalancer

If the Pedalshift service account locks out, stop the rebalancing cron first. Then run the recovery CLI with the ops profile and confirm dock telemetry resumes. Do not rotate keys mid-recovery. The passphrase needed to unlock the recovery keystore follows on the next line.

unlock words, kagef-taduf: fenir-quenix-norwyn-sorvan-gormir-gorir-fraok

TICKET LIFT-482: ElevDispatch Sim dropping DB connections

New folks: the LiftWorks elevator-dispatch simulator fails intermittently when pulling car-assignment data. Pool exhausts after ~200 sim ticks; retries time out. Suspect stale pool config after the Pellaro cluster migration. Restarting the sim masks it. Check pool size and idle timeout first. To reproduce locally, point the sim at the staging store using the connection string below.

replica DSN, yahaf-yagaf: mongodb://tamath_svc:a2netSk3RZMuTj@db-d084.novacsoft.internal:5432/ralmir